ireport怎样插入一张相对路径的图片,希望具体到按钮的 *** 作哦

ireport怎样插入一张相对路径的图片,希望具体到按钮的 *** 作哦,第1张

解决办法是,穿入一个$P的参数,表示图片所在的目录,然后用$P和文件名拼接出

完整的绝对路径. 更好的方法是用InputStream, 例如this.getClass().getResourceAsStream("logo.jpg") ,这时只要把图片放在

当前. jasper所在的目录就可以了,不必考虑什么参数,什么路径了

或者建议你用FineReport,直接邮寄单元格元素,插入图片。FineReport用的人还是蛮多的,ing好用的

使用 HTML预览的时候 插图的图片不断重复,这个问题是父格扩展的设置有误了,如果你插入的图片的父格是可扩展的的数据集,那么有多少条数据,这个图片就要重复多少次。我用的是finereport,上面的解法是他的,但都是报表软件,原理应该跟ireport一致。

默认情况下,图例中显示了类别来标识每个值。如果使用了类别标签标记饼图,则可能希望在图例中显示百分比。

在饼图上显示百分比值

向报表添加一个饼图。有关详细信息,请参阅如何向报表添加图表 (Report Builder 2.0)。

在设计图面上,右键单击饼图并选择“显示数据标签”。数据标签应显示在饼图上的每个切片上。

在设计图面上,右键单击标签并选择“序列标签属性”。此时将显示“序列标签属性”对话框。

在“标签数据”选项中键入 #PERCENT。

在饼图的图例中显示百分比值

在设计图面上,右键单击饼图并选择“序列属性”。此时将显示“序列属性”对话框。

在“图例”的“自定义图例文本”属性中键入 #PERCENT。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/bake/11320442.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-15
下一篇 2023-05-15

发表评论

登录后才能评论

评论列表(0条)

保存